Abstract

This invention relates to the field of biomass boiler technology, specifically to a boiler furnace temperature co-regulation system based on biomass co-firing. The system includes a tube panel, a coolant delivery pipe, and a zone temperature detection unit. The tube panel comprises several pipe rows and flat steel bars surrounding the furnace. The coolant delivery pipe is equipped with a first branch pipe, a second branch pipe, and a first electrically controlled valve. The delivery end of the tube panel is connected to the first branch pipe of the coolant delivery pipe, and the second branch pipe is connected to a straight pipe. The straight pipe is equipped with several connecting pipes, a coolant direct conveyor, and a second electrically controlled valve. The zone temperature detection unit includes several temperature sensors. This technical solution achieves flexible switching of the coolant delivery path and targeted cooling of localized high-temperature areas in the furnace through precise signal linkage between the temperature sensors of the zone temperature detection unit and the coolant direct conveyors on both sides of the pipe rows.
